Description

Twenty years ago Grace Mazur brought Thermomix to Australia. Since then Thermomix has become a household name across Australia and New Zealand, with over half a million families, passionate cooks, chefs and influencers embracing this cutting-edge appliance that can literally do everything in one, from weighing, chopping, blending, grinding, kneading, cooking and so much more. To celebrate 20 years in Australia, this beautiful new cookbook tells the story of Thermomix's journey through delicious recipes that inspired cooks at the time (and still do!) and delightful stories that highlight just how this amazing appliance has helped create something truly incredible for all of us.

Author Biography:

Are Media Books creates, publishes and distributes a variety of books, including cooking, health, lifestyle, coffee table, home, gift and design within Australia and overseas. Are Media Books is home to The Australian Women's Weekly's brand of cookbooks. We have produced more food content globally than any other publisher across the globe. Are Media Books' sales have exceeded more than 80 million copies, in 18 languages, across 100 countries. Are Media Books is a division of Are Media Australia.
